"There are small ways to make a difference," says Peace Advocacy Network's Ed Coffin, and it's OK if you're not sure where to start. PAN's activist training session includes tips on how to develop involvement and insight into the pursuit of change. Whether you want to raise awareness about how food choices affect the environment or protest horse carriages in Old City, Coffin says the training will teach passionate people how to take the first step toward assembling support for any cause.
Sat., Feb. 26, 7 p.m., free, Wooden Shoe Books, 704 South St., 215-413-0999, woodenshoebooks.com.
